| UniProt functional annotation for F1LMZ8 | |||
| UniProt code: F1LMZ8. |
| Organism: | Rattus norvegicus (Rat). | |
| Taxonomy: | Eukaryota; Metazoa; Chordata; Craniata; Vertebrata; Euteleostomi; Mammalia; Eutheria; Euarchontoglires; Glires; Rodentia; Myomorpha; Muroidea; Muridae; Murinae; Rattus. | |
| Function: | Component of the 26S proteasome, a multiprotein complex involved in the ATP-dependent degradation of ubiquitinated proteins. This complex plays a key role in the maintenance of protein homeostasis by removing misfolded or damaged proteins, which could impair cellular functions, and by removing proteins whose functions are no longer required. Therefore, the proteasome participates in numerous cellular processes, including cell cycle progression, apoptosis, or DNA damage repair. In the complex, PSMD11 is required for proteasome assembly. Plays a key role in increased proteasome activity in embryonic stem cells (ESCs): its high expression in ESCs promotes enhanced assembly of the 26S proteasome, followed by higher proteasome activity. {ECO:0000250|UniProtKB:O00231}. | |
| Subunit: | Component of the 19S proteasome regulatory particle complex. The 26S proteasome consists of a 20S core particle (CP) and two 19S regulatory subunits (RP). The regulatory particle is made of a lid composed of 9 subunits including PSMD11, a base containing 6 ATPases and few additional components. {ECO:0000250|UniProtKB:O00231}. | |
| Subcellular location: | Nucleus {ECO:0000250}. Cytoplasm, cytosol {ECO:0000250}. | |
| Ptm: | Phosphorylated by AMPK. {ECO:0000250}. | |
| Similarity: | Belongs to the proteasome subunit S9 family. {ECO:0000305}. | |
